PALO ALTO, Calif., -- HP right now announced it's completed its acquisition of Palm Inc. at a price tag of $5.70 for each reveal of Palm widespread stock in dollars.

HP’s global scale and economic strength in addition Palm’s award-winning webOS experience, also as its acclaimed Pre and Pixi smartphone merchandise lines, enhance HP’s capability to take part a lot more aggressively in the extremely lucrative, $100 billion smartphone and linked cellular gadget markets.
“With webOS, HP will supply its clients a exclusive and persuasive expertise across smartphones as well as other mobility goods,” mentioned Todd Bradley, executive vice president, Personal Systems Group, HP. “This allows us the opportunity to fully engage in increasing our smartphone family members supplying and the footprint of webOS.”
Under Jon Rubinstein, former Palm chairman and chief executive officer, the Palm worldwide business unit will report to Bradley. Palm will be accountable for webOS application growth and webOS primarily based hardware products, from a robust smartphone roadmap to future slate PCs and netbooks.
“With HP’s entire backing and world-wide strengths, I’m assured that webOS will be capable to get to its entire prospective,” explained Rubinstein. ”This arrangement will speed up the development of this amazing platform with new sources, scale and support from a world-respected brand.”
